Manchester United and Liverpool seem to be in a bitter struggle with each other. Both English clubs want the signature of James Rodríguez under a contract.

The dethroned champion of England want to pay 25 million for the Colombian winger. Liverpool has a bad season behind them and are preparing a bid of around 28.5 million for the twenty-year-old.
Rodríguez himself does have ears for a move and a higher wage. Agent Silvio Sandri has said some interesting things in the O Jogo newspaper: "This is something that should be discussed with Porto. I can not say anything about this because it is very complex."

Edited the Google translate.

Basically ManU's offered 25 million and Liverpool 28,5. Rodriguez is keen to a move and a higher salary.

In the Arsenal system RVP is the main man and the other attackers base their game around him that is why Walcott and Song formed such a fantastic understanding because RVP is all over the place forcing defenders to follow him and taking them out of position and making room. RVP is a fantastic striker because of this but it requires his teammates to go along with this and the Dutch don't know how and prefer to rely on individual brilliance or a bit of luck to win games. Arsenal's attacking system works fantastic for RVP that's why he scores a lot of goals for us and as long as he stays fit he will keep scoring for us because that's the way our system is.

RVP was tired. He played a lot of games for Arsenal and since Arsenal's attack was poor had to do a lot of work in those games as everything in Arsenal's attack went through him.
